UK - Sony unveiled new functions for its DWX series at Prolight+Sound. The digital wireless microphone platform for studio and ENG is now available with an extended frequency spectrum with four different channels, as well as new features in the free Wireless Studio 4.0 studio software. This will make wireless microphone use on stage or in TV transmission even more convenient.

The new version of the DWR-R02D digital wireless 19" rack-mount receiver has a bandwidth of 72MHz in the frequency spectrum from 470MHz to 542MHz. With the three other channel versions, the DWX series now covers a range from 470MHz to 788MHz. The digital microphone platform supports 35 out of 39 European TV channels and is at the forefront of frequency coverage in Europe.

UK - Artistic Licence has announced a significant upgrade to its popular free software application, DMX-Workshop.

Designed as a network management, analysis, configuration and diagnostics tool for Art-Net networks, DMX-Workshop now offers an improved user interface and sophisticated new functionality. This includes a 'ping radar' for instant node detection, data packet analysers for both Art-Net and RDM over Art-Net, and the ability to transmit sACN and KiNET data.

Not to be left out, the handy Bandwidth-Tester application has also undergone a major overhaul. Bandwidth-Tester is designed to allow stress testing of a network by transmitting multiple universes of lighting data. The new version allows the user to select unicast operation in Art-Net 3 mode or to broadcast data for worst case network analysis. Denmark - The eye-catching Black Diamond cultural centre in Copenhagen is a modern waterfront extension to the old Royal Danish Library building. Earning its quasi-official nickname from its polished black granite cladding and irregular angles, it houses a number of public facilities, centred round its top-lit atrium.

One of the main features of the centre is The Queen's Hall, a 600-seat auditorium used for a variety of events ranging from classical and jazz concerts to literary events and conferences. The hall's cutting-edge acoustic modelling allows for sound reinforcement that can be adjusted to the specific requirements of the type of music being played. This, in theory, made the venue ideal for the recording of classical music, but the noise generated by the existing lighting system rendered this impossible.
